Archeologsts have recently discovered graves of ancient Russian family of Ruriks (“Rurik” means “famous ruler”) in the town of Zmeinogorsk, reports famous Russian historian.
The discovery was totally unexpected – fellows of local historical centre have taken children from historical society to perform diggings on the city’s cemetery, and among other pre-revolutionary burials they found graves of Ruriks.
Now scientists start enormous research – they are going to identify the graves and bodies in them.
